Clark County Green Schools and EarthGen are excited to welcome middle and high school students at our upcoming Secondary Student Summit! The summit will take place on Thursday, November 7th from 9am-1pm at Clark College. Each school can bring up to 10 students and 2 chaperones. Lunch will be provided, and schools can request substitute and transportation reimbursement from Sami. Please reach out to her at samantha.springslecain@clark.wa.gov with any questions. 

The theme is "From Classroom to Community: How Youth Can Take Local Climate Action." Students will take a deep dive into agricultural and urban health topics, interact with local partners and create meaningful connections with other students in the county. Our goal is that they leave feeling energized and ready to take action in their communities!
